Commercial Slab Installation in Cumming, GA
Commercial slab installation services involve preparing and pouring concrete foundations for various types of property projects, including parking lots, storage facilities, retail spaces, and industrial buildings. This process typically includes site preparation, formwork setup, reinforcement placement, and pouring the concrete to create a durable, level surface that supports ongoing construction or operational needs. Property owners often request this service to establish a solid base for new structures, improve existing surfaces, or accommodate specific load requirements for commercial activities.
Before requesting commercial slab installation,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the project, including site conditions, load capacity, and any necessary permits or regulations. It’s also helpful to consider the intended use of the slab, as this influences the thickness, reinforcement, and finishing details. Clear communication about project expectations and site specifics ensures the installation meets both safety standards and functional requirements for the property’s future use.

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require commercial slab installation? Commercial slab installation is comm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the most common material, often reinforced with steel to ensure durability and strength for heavy use.
How does the site preparation impact the slab installation? Proper site preparation, including grading and soil compaction, helps ensure the slab remains stable and prevents cracking or shifting over time.
What should property owners consider before installation? It's important to assess the intended use, load requirements, and drainage needs to select the appropriate slab design and thickness.
